French Early 19th Century Silk and Angora Aubusson Tapestry Pillow with Flowers

$ 1,995
  • Description
    A French silk and angora pillow made from an early 19th century Aubusson tapestry, with floral décor and Allegory of the Liberal Arts. Made from a tapestry created during the early years of the 19th century in the Aubusson Manufacture located in central France, this silk and angora pillow is adorned with delicate flowers, surrounding objects symbolizing the Liberal Arts. These motifs stand out beautifully on a neutral background and are framed with petite tassels on the surround. With its exquisite motifs, this early 19th century Aubusson silk and angora pillow will bring a touch of French elegance to any sofa, canapé or settee.
